Description

Stone Town Tour est une visite où vous pouvez découvrir le cœur de la culture de Zanzibar et comprendre notre mode de vie à Zanzibar. En tant que poste de traite principal sur les routes du commerce des épices, de la soie et des esclaves depuis plus d'un millénaire, Stone Town a été un lieu de rencontre unique, mêlant les cultures africaines, indiennes, arabes et européennes. C'est l'une des rares villes antiques restantes en Afrique. Sa beauté et sa valeur historique lui ont valu une place bien méritée sur la liste du patrimoine mondial de l'UNESCO.

Itinéraire

5 min

Notre guide commencera par vous donner des informations sur la ville de pierre, puis vous commencerez votre visite en vous promenant devant le bâtiment House of Wonder et en vous faisant découvrir l'histoire du bâtiment. il est également connu sous le nom de Beit Al Jaib.

Entrée incluse12 min

Nous irons au vieux fort, également connu sous le nom de Ngome Kongwe, nous entrerons à l'intérieur du bâtiment et nous nous arrêterons quelques minutes, le guide expliquera l'histoire du bâtiment Ngome Kongwe en tant que principal marché de la traite des esclaves par l'histoire.

5 min

Nous nous arrêterons à la maison où est né le célèbre musicien de l'histoire, le nom du musicien est Freddie Mercury, le guide vous expliquera l'histoire intéressante de sa vie devant pendant que vous prenez des photos à l'extérieur du bâtiment de Freddie Mercury.

60 min

Après avoir visité les bâtiments historiques, le guide vous emmènera faire une promenade le long de la rue Stone Town et des bazars, vous vous arrêterez également à l'église catholique et prendrez des photos. Vous irez voir le style de porte indien et plus tard le style de porte arabe. Le guide vous expliquera plus de détails sur ce type de porte de Zanzibar au fur et à mesure que vous prendrez des photos et passerez dans les rues.

Entrée incluse12 min

Vous entrerez dans l'église cathédrale anglicane au point de contrôle, vous entrerez dans une salle contenant des panneaux contenant des informations clés sur l'histoire de la traite des esclaves, puis le guide vous conduira à la chambre des esclaves, puis vous serez conduit aux sculptures d'esclaves. .

20 min

Le guide vous emmènera dans les meilleurs magasins du bazar de Darajani aux épices de Zanzibar, qui vous intéressent, que vous achèterez comme vous le souhaitez pour ramener chez vous.
